Chris Berger: Andy left DD not just to pursue a solo career. There were dynamics in the band that just weren't working out. He and Nick had some serious clashes, for starters. Plus, he had issues with the Berrows brothers, the first managers of Duran Duran. He wanted out from under them, and according to the contract, there were certain steps he had to take if he didn't want their management over his head. Read his book "Wild Boy." He talks about it in there.
